Mennonite Weekly Review obituary: 1960 May 5 p. 3

Birth date: 1942

text of obituary:

YOUNG MAN KILLED IN CAR-TRUCK CRASH

Sugarcreek, Ohio. — The collision of a pickup truck and a car on Ohio Highway 8 near the Summit-Stark county line April 26 proved fatal to 18-year-old Raymond Schrock, of Hartville.

The young man was the son of Mr. and Mrs. Henry Schrock, now living at Sarasota, Fla.


Mennonite Weekly Review obituary: 1960 May 19 p. 6

text of obituary:

FUNERAL SERVICES AT HARTVILLE, OHIO LARGELY ATTENDED

Hartville, Ohio. — The Hartville Mennonite church was filled to overflowing Saturday afternoon April 30, as funeral services were held for Raymond Schrock, 18, who was fatally injured in a highway crash.

The young man, son of Mr. and Mrs. Henry H. Schrock, was a passenger in a pick-up truck driven by Vernon Wagler, who was in critical condition with a fractured pelvis and internal injuries. Lavern Raber, another passenger, sustained back and head injuries.
